Position location:

Dajarra Primary Health Care Clinic, North West Hospital and Health Service, Queensland.

Dajarra is a predominantly Aboriginal community located approximately 155km southeast of Mount Isa, connected by a single laned bitumen road. It is serviced by a sealed fenced runway providing 24-hour aeromedical access to the community. The town has a roadhouse and a local pub both which provide fuel, accommodation and meals. There is a campdraft facility that hosts the annual Dajarra Campdraft and rodeo. Mount Isa is the closest town and is located about a 2-hour drive for groceries, shopping and metropolitan services. There is no public transport service. 

Dajarra PHC operates a nurse practitioner led model of care with a focus on primary health care, community engagement and collaborative case management of clients with complex chronic conditions. The location of the clinic on a highway with tourist and industry through-put also requires management of episodic and emergency and trauma presentations, including operation of the Hospital Based Ambulance Service when required.
